Società Sportiva Murata is a San Marines football club from Murata , a district (Curazia) of the city ​​of San Marino .

history

The association was founded in 1966. In 1985 he was one of the 17 teams that took part in the first championship, which was played in the A1 series . The club narrowly escaped relegation by two points. In 1988, however, the transition to the second class had to be started when one was only penultimate. However, the immediate recovery succeeded and in the following years they occupied midfield. 1993/94, the club qualified for the first time for the championship playoffs, but retired with a 1: 3 defeat in the first game against FC Domagnano .

The first title win came in 1997 when SS Virtus could be beaten 2-0 in the cup final. In the following years they managed to qualify for the playoffs several times in the championship, but were regularly eliminated in the first round. It was only in the 2000/01 season that they could progress, the end of the line was in the semi-finals after a 0-1 win against SS Cosmos . The club have made it to the finals every time since 2003, and in 2005 SS Murata made it to the final for the first time. However, FC Domagnano prevailed with 1: 2.

In the following season as leaders of the Girone B succeeded in qualifying for the finals, in which they remained undefeated and through a goal by Alex Gasperoni against the final opponent SS Pennarossa for the first time San-Marinese champions.

In 2007, the team achieved their second cup victory after beating Libertas Borgo Maggiore 2-1 in the final. In 2007, Murata also took part for the first time in history (it was the first time a club from San Marino took part in the Champions League qualification part) in the Champions League.

In the first qualifying round they met Finnish champions Tampere United . At home they even took a 1-0 lead, but Tampere was able to turn the game around with two goals in the second half. Still, it was a strong performance. In the second leg in Finland, the San Marines lost to Tampere United 0-2.

In 2008 Murata again took part in the Champions League qualification. The opponent in the first qualifying round is the Swedish champions IFK Göteborg . For these two games Murata wanted to sign seven-time Formula 1 world champion Michael Schumacher .

The most famous player in the club's history is the Brazilian Aldair . The three-time World Cup participant joined the team in 2007.

European Cup balance sheet

season competition round opponent total To Back
2006/07 Uefa cup 1st qualifying round Cyprus RepublicRepublic of Cyprus APOEL Nicosia 1: 7 1: 3 (A) 0: 4 (H)
2007/08 UEFA Champions League 1st qualifying round FinlandFinland Tampere United 1: 4 1: 2 (H) 0: 2 (A)
2008/09 UEFA Champions League 1st qualifying round SwedenSweden IFK Gothenburg 0: 9 0: 5 (H) 0: 4 (A)
Legend: (H) - home game, (A) - away game, (N) - neutral place, (a) - away goal rule , (i. E.) - on penalties , (n. V.) - after extra time

Overall record: 6 games, 6 defeats, 2:20 goals (goal difference −18)
